Schloss Gemuenden opened in 1301. It is owned and lived in by the van Salis family, so still in private family hands. It is not really open for visits, but is available for events, weddings, and such both inside and outside. In particular the gewolbe cellar is very nice, and the lovely terrace is very nice and has a great view of Gemuenden. Horn Castle is located about 600 m west of Horn in a marshy headwater area of the Klingelbach. The impressive 4-5 m high, round castle mound has a diameter of 40 m. A 9-12 m wide, in places 1.5 m deep moat surrounds the castle mound. A well is said to have been uncovered in the partly silted up, partly still swampy ditch. The round hill plateau with a diameter of approx. 20 m shows an approx. 2 m deep trough or a wall-like elevation that encloses the plateau. horn-hunsrueck.de/horner-burg

Are there any castles with unique historical features?

Yes, Horner Castle (Old Ring Wall) is a unique medieval castle hill with a diameter of 40 meters, surrounded by a 9-12 meter wide ditch. Marksburg Castle, further along the Middle Rhine, is also unique as the only hilltop castle in that stretch that has never been destroyed, offering insights into medieval life.
